What is Magnesium Glycinate?

Magnesium glycinate is a compound formed by combining magnesium with glycine, an amino acid. This combination enhances the absorption of magnesium in the body, making it more effective than other forms of magnesium, such as magnesium oxide or magnesium sulfate. Due to its high bioavailability, magnesium glycinate is often recommended for individuals looking to increase their magnesium levels.

Benefits of 650 mg Magnesium Glycinate

1. Promotes Relaxation and Sleep
One of the most well-known benefits of magnesium glycinate is its ability to promote relaxation and improve sleep quality. Magnesium plays a crucial role in regulating neurotransmitters that send signals to the nervous system, helping to calm anxiety and support restful sleep. Taking 650 mg of magnesium glycinate before bedtime may help you fall asleep faster and enjoy a deeper sleep.

2. Supports Muscle Function and Recovery
Magnesium is vital for muscle function, and a deficiency can lead to cramps, spasms, and fatigue. By taking 650 mg magnesium glycinate, you can support your muscles during workouts and aid in recovery after physical activity. This makes it a popular choice among athletes and fitness enthusiasts.

3. Enhances Mood and Mental Clarity
Magnesium plays a role in brain health and cognitive function. Studies suggest that adequate magnesium levels may help alleviate symptoms of stress and anxiety, leading to improved mood and mental clarity. Incorporating 650 mg magnesium glycinate into your daily routine may contribute to better overall mental well-being.

4. Supports Cardiovascular Health
Magnesium is essential for maintaining a healthy heart. It helps regulate blood pressure, supports healthy cholesterol levels, and promotes overall cardiovascular function. Regular intake of magnesium glycinate may help reduce the risk of heart disease and improve heart health.

5. Aids Digestive Health
Magnesium glycinate can also help support digestive health by promoting regular bowel movements and preventing constipation. It works by relaxing the muscles in the digestive tract, making it easier for food to pass through.

Potential Side Effects

While magnesium glycinate is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may experience mild side effects, including digestive upset, diarrhea, or stomach cramps. If you experience any adverse effects, it’s important to consult with a healthcare professional to adjust your dosage or explore alternative forms of magnesium.
